Capital Subaru Gifts SUV to Ukrainian Family
Icon Plus

On Wednesday, August 10th, Capital Subaru proudly donated a Subaru Forester to a recently resettled Ukrainian family here in St. John's. Oleksi Senyk along with wife Tata and son Myron arrived in Newfoundland and Labrador on June 14th, 2022, from Dnipro, Ukraine. 2022 Ronald McDonald House Outback Presentation
Icon Plus

We are so proud to present Ronald McDonald House Newfoundland and Labrador with a brand new Subaru Outback! This shuttle will help the families staying at Ronald McDonald House and ensure staff can continue their fundraising activities across NL. 2021 Law Enforcement Torch Run Newfoundland and Labrador
Icon Plus

Congratulations to Law Enforcement Agencies on raising awareness and funds for Special Olympics Newfoundland and Labrador with their Law Enforcement Torch Run Newfoundland and Labrador! Capital Subaru GM – Greg Stowe along with Mgr – Chris Smith were happy to present a cheque today for $500 and congratulate the group on a job well done! #capitalcommunity
